Requirements

  • Bachelor’s degree in mechanical engineering, Aerospace Engineering, or a closely related field. A master’s degree is a plus
  • 7+ years of experience in mechanical engineering, with a minimum of 5 years directly involved in certification, compliance, or regulatory affairs within the power generation, aerospace, or oil and gas industries, specifically with gas turbine engines or major rotating machinery
  • Strong understanding of gas turbine thermodynamics, performance, mechanical design, and combustion/emissions control
  • Proven experience interpreting and applying major industry standards (e.g., ASME B7, API 616) and working with regulatory bodies
  • Excellent written and verbal communication skills for preparing reports and negotiating with regulatory authorities
  • Ability to manage multiple certification projects concurrently under strict deadlines
  • Working knowledge of Creo is preferred

Responsibilities

  • Interpret and apply industry standards (e.g., ASME, ISO, API, IEC, NFPA, OSHA) and regulatory requirements (e.g., FAA, EASA, EPA) to gas turbine design and manufacturing processes
  • Maintain up-to-date knowledge of evolving certification standards and regulatory changes impacting gas turbine technology
  • Maintain compliance and certification from project booking to shipment
  • Develop and execute global certification strategies
  • Support Sales, Packaging application Engineer, and Business Development
  • Participate in industry standards development
  • Review engineering designs, drawings, and technical specifications to identify potential compliance issues early in the development cycle
  • Work with R&D, design, and manufacturing teams to implement necessary design changes for certification
  • Develop and oversee certification test plans (including performance, vibration, stress, and emissions testing) in collaboration with test engineers
  • Analyze test data and results to demonstrate compliance with certification requirements
  • Prepare, review, and maintain comprehensive certification documentation, including Type Certificates, Supplemental Type Certificates (STCs), compliance matrices, and substantiation reports
  • Act as the primary technical liaison with certification agencies and regulatory bodies, managing audits and resolving technical queries
  • Conduct formal safety assessments, failure analysis (e.g., OSHA, FMEA, FTA), and reliability studies to support the certification basis

About Caterpillar Inc.

Caterpillar Inc. designs and manufactures heavy machinery and equipment for industries such as construction, mining, energy, and rail. Their products include a wide range of machinery and engines that help clients complete large-scale projects. Caterpillar's equipment works by providing powerful tools that can perform tasks like digging, lifting, and transporting materials. What sets Caterpillar apart from its competitors is its strong aftermarket support, which includes maintenance and repair services, ensuring that their machinery remains efficient and reliable over time. The company's goal is to deliver high-quality products while also focusing on sustainability and community development through initiatives that improve education and reduce poverty.
